Job summary

Jobtailor is seeking a seasoned relationship manager for mortgage servicing, focusing on client services, data analysis, and process improvements. You will coordinate with investors, manage counterparty relationships, and participate in senior management presentations to ensure high-quality service delivery.

The role requires strong Excel skills, familiarity with MortgageServ/Fiserv, and the ability to work in a hybrid setup with occasional travel.
